14:22 — Offline sync regression confirmed (Terrapath field-survey app)

At 14:22 the on-call engineer reproduced the data-loss path: surveys saved while offline were marked synced once connectivity returned, even when the upload was rejected. The queue flush skipped the server acknowledgement check introduced in the previous sprint. Release manager note: the fix must ship before the coastal survey season. The offending build is identified by the token recorded below.

session token of kawif-fawig = htk31_f3f599be2b1a34affb1efa8d0feccf8

Ticket #4417 — Splitwing assignment service vault locked

During the 3.2 release prep for Splitwing, our A/B experiment assignment service, the config vault auto-locked after three failed unseal attempts by the deploy runner. Bucketing still works from cache, but new experiment definitions cannot be published until the vault is reopened. Per the Harrowgate release checklist, the release manager must perform the unseal personally before the cutover window closes. The recovery passphrase is below.

vault phrase of tajeg-tageg = pelix-druix-holius-briael-zorwyn-frawyn-fraox-norok-drueth-aldiel

## Sensor drift: what to do at 3am

If the GrowLoop controller starts reporting humidity swings that don't match the backup probes in the Fernwick greenhouse, it's almost always sensor drift, not an actual climate event. Don't panic and don't touch the vents manually. First, restart the calibration daemon and give it ten minutes to re-baseline. If readings still disagree by more than 5%, flip the controller into safe mode. The safe-mode thresholds it will use are these.

config for yahap-bajof:
[istix]
host = istix.qorvelsys.internal
user = istix_svc
database = istix_prod

## Authentication

Driftgate runs schema migrations with zero downtime by shadow-writing to the replica set before cutover. Every migration step authenticates against the Ledgerline coordination service, which serializes DDL changes across shards. If authentication fails mid-migration, Driftgate halts safely and leaves both schemas intact — do not retry manually without confirming the lock state first. On-call engineers should verify the coordinator is reachable before resuming, then authenticate with the key that follows.

service key, fawip-bajef: kto11_Qt5wZK9vdNC